Late Edo Period Japanese Silk Patchwork Boro Wall Hanging Decorative and 110 cm wire andHere we have a beautiful, small antique Japanese boro textile fragment made of silk. This particular piece of boro originates from Japan dating from the late Edo to early Meiji Period. Composed of multiple indigo dyed silk fragments, carefully patched together over time. Historically boro was primarily used by rural, working class households to repair, reinforce, and extend the life of worn out garments and household items like bedding (futon covers)
